轻松实现WordPress文章首行缩进

根据中国人的书写方法,首行缩进两个字符看起来让人更舒服,wordpress自带的要在文本模式下切换到全角输入法,然后在首行加空格,今天介绍一个简单的方法,可以统一实现首航进俩个字符。我们可以用函数的方法实现,也可以直接修改css代码,方法非常其实很简单。

1.函数方法

打开function.php,在里面加上下列代码
[code lang=”php” line_numbers=”linenums”]/**
*WordPress 文章首行缩进
*/
function Bing_paragraph_indentation( $content ){
return str_replace( '<p', '<p style="text-indent:2em;"', $content );
}
add_filter( 'the_content', 'Bing_paragraph_indentation' );[/code]
以上这段代码就是将文章中的<p标签替换成<p style="text-indent: 2em;"

2.添加css代码

我们也可以直接在主题根目录下的style.css文件中添加如下代码即可.entry p{text-indent: 2em}本站是用第二种方法实现的首航缩进功能。
OK!现在检查一下你的文章是不是都自动实现了首行缩进,本站是使用第二种方法实现的此功能。

发表评论

游客欢迎您123